在数字化时代,科技与生活的融合日益紧密,健康管理领域也不例外。API(应用程序编程接口)作为一种连接不同软件和服务的技术手段,正在改变我们如何监测、分析和改善个人健康。本文将深入探讨API在健康管理中的应用,以及如何利用科技守护你的健康生活。
API:连接健康数据的桥梁
API是软件之间相互通信的桥梁,它允许不同的系统和应用程序共享数据。在健康管理领域,API可以连接各种设备和平台,如智能手表、健康监测应用程序、医院信息系统等,从而实现数据的实时同步和分析。
数据收集:从源头开始
健康管理的第一步是收集数据。通过API,智能设备可以自动上传用户的健康数据,如心率、血压、睡眠质量、运动步数等。这些数据为后续的健康分析提供了基础。
# 假设这是一个用于收集用户步数的API调用示例
import requests
def get_step_count(user_id):
url = f"https://api.healthtracker.com/step_count/{user_id}"
response = requests.get(url)
if response.status_code == 200:
return response.json()['step_count']
else:
return None
# 获取用户ID
user_id = '123456789'
# 获取步数
step_count = get_step_count(user_id)
print(f"Today's step count: {step_count}")
数据分析:洞察健康趋势
收集到数据后,API可以帮助分析这些数据,揭示健康趋势和潜在问题。例如,通过分析心率数据,可以预测心脏病的风险。
# 假设这是一个用于分析心率数据的API调用示例
def analyze_heart_rate(user_id):
url = f"https://api.healthtracker.com/heart_rate_analysis/{user_id}"
response = requests.get(url)
if response.status_code == 200:
return response.json()['analysis']
else:
return None
# 分析心率
heart_rate_analysis = analyze_heart_rate(user_id)
print(f"Heart rate analysis: {heart_rate_analysis}")
个性化建议:根据数据定制方案
基于分析结果,API可以提供个性化的健康建议。例如,如果你的睡眠质量不佳,API可能会推荐你调整作息时间或进行放松训练。
# 假设这是一个提供个性化健康建议的API调用示例
def get_health_advice(user_id):
url = f"https://api.healthtracker.com/health_advice/{user_id}"
response = requests.get(url)
if response.status_code == 200:
return response.json()['advice']
else:
return None
# 获取健康建议
health_advice = get_health_advice(user_id)
print(f"Health advice: {health_advice}")
科技守护健康生活
利用API进行健康管理,不仅可以让你更了解自己的身体状况,还能帮助你采取行动改善健康。以下是一些利用科技守护健康生活的建议:
- 定期检查:利用智能设备定期检查健康数据,及时发现潜在问题。
- 跟踪进度:记录健康数据的变化,了解自己的健康状况是否有所改善。
- 个性化计划:根据API提供的建议,制定个性化的健康计划。
- 持续学习:关注健康领域的最新研究,不断调整自己的健康策略。
总之,API健康管理是科技与生活相结合的产物,它为我们的健康生活提供了更多可能性。通过合理利用API,我们可以更好地了解自己的身体状况,从而守护健康生活。
